Respect for individual human rights (V164)

Data file: WV5_Data_Hong_Kong_2005_Spss_v20180912

Overview

Valid: 1233
Invalid: 19
Minimum: 1
Maximum: 4
Type: Discrete
Decimal: 0
Start: 479
End: 480
Width: 2
Range: 1 - 4
Format: Numeric

Questions and instructions

Literal question
V164. How much respect is there for individual human rights nowadays in this country? Do you feel there is (read out and code one answer):
Categories
Value Category Cases
1 A lot of respect for individual human rights 68
5.5%
2 Some respect 995
80.7%
3 Not much respect 155
12.6%
4 Not respect at all 15
1.2%
-5 Missing; Not asked by the interviewer 0
-4 Not asked 0
-3 Not applicable 0
-2 No answer 19
-1 Don´t know 0
Warning: these figures indicate the number of cases found in the data file. They cannot be interpreted as summary statistics of the population of interest.
